黑狐家游戏

源码如何建立网站,从零开始构建个性化在线平台,源码怎么做网站

欧气 1 0

本文目录导读:

  1. 确定网站目标与定位
  2. 选择合适的编程语言与技术框架
  3. 设计网站架构与布局
  4. 编写HTML文档
  5. 应用CSS样式美化界面
  6. 引入JavaScript增强互动体验
  7. 后端程序开发与管理数据库

在当今数字化时代,拥有一个属于自己的网站已经不再是遥不可及的梦想,无论是个人博客、企业官网还是电子商务平台,通过编写源代码,我们可以轻松地创建出满足自己需求的个性化在线平台,本文将详细介绍如何利用源码来建立一个功能丰富且美观的网站。

源码如何建立网站,从零开始构建个性化在线平台,源码怎么做网站

图片来源于网络,如有侵权联系删除

确定网站目标与定位

在动手之前,首先要明确自己的网站目标和受众群体,这将有助于后续的设计和开发工作更加有的放矢。

目标设定:

  • 个人展示:用于分享生活点滴、作品集或专业技能等。
  • 商业推广:作为公司产品的宣传窗口或者服务介绍的平台。
  • 信息发布:定期更新新闻动态、活动通知等内容。

受众分析:

  • 年龄层:了解主要访问者的年龄段可以帮助选择合适的色彩搭配和技术栈。
  • 兴趣点:关注他们的喜好和行为习惯,以便更好地吸引用户注意力。

选择合适的编程语言与技术框架

根据不同的需求和预算,可以选择不同的编程语言和技术栈来搭建网站。

前端技术:

  • HTML/CSS/JavaScript:经典的三剑客组合,适用于大多数网页开发场景。
  • React/Vue/Angular:现代前端框架,支持组件化和模块化开发,提高效率和质量。
  • Webpack/Gulp/Webpack:构建工具,优化打包流程,提升项目性能。

后端技术:

  • Node.js/Python/Django/PHP:流行的后端语言,各自有不同的特点和适用场景。
  • RESTful API设计:定义清晰的数据接口,方便前后端分离开发和管理。
  • 数据库管理:MySQL/PostgreSQL/MongoDB等关系型和非关系型数据库的选择。

设计网站架构与布局

合理的网站结构能够提升用户体验,同时也有利于未来的扩展和维护。

首页设计:

  • 导航栏:简洁明了的分类标签,引导访客快速找到所需信息。
  • :突出显示最新动态、热门文章或产品推荐等关键元素。
  • 侧边栏:放置广告位、友情链接或其他辅助性信息。

页面层级结构:

  • 一级页面:首页、关于我们、联系我们等基础页面。
  • 二级页面:具体的产品详情页、博客分类列表页等。
  • 三级页面:深入的文章正文、下载中心等细节页面。

编写HTML文档

HTML是构成网页的基本骨架,负责组织和呈现文本、图片、视频等各种媒体资源。

源码如何建立网站,从零开始构建个性化在线平台,源码怎么做网站

图片来源于网络,如有侵权联系删除

标签使用:

  • 头部标签:内包含元数据、样式表引用等。
  • 主体部分:中放置所有可见内容,如标题、段落、表格等。
  • 语义化标记:使用

    -

      /
        等标准化的标签进行排版和组织。

    元数据优化:

      :影响搜索引擎排名的关键因素之一。
    • 描述:为搜索结果添加简要说明。
    • 关键词:帮助搜索引擎识别主题词。

    应用CSS样式美化界面

    CSS负责控制页面的外观和布局,使静态的HTML文件变得生动有趣。

    布局技巧:

    • Flexbox/Grid系统:灵活应对不同屏幕尺寸的需求,实现响应式设计。
    • 网格布局:整齐排列各种元素,增强视觉效果。

    色彩搭配原则:

    • 对比度:确保文字可读性和视觉吸引力之间的平衡。
    • 协调性:避免过于杂乱的颜色组合,保持整体一致性。

    动画效果:

    • 简单易用的动画库:如jQuery animate()方法或CSS transitions。
    • 交互式反馈:点击按钮时的微动效,增加用户体验感。

    引入JavaScript增强互动体验

    JavaScript让网站变得更加智能和人性化,可以实现丰富的客户端操作。

    功能实现:

    • 表单验证:防止无效输入导致的错误提交。
    • 滑轮滚动:平滑过渡到下一个页面或内容区域。
    • 下拉菜单:节省空间的同时提供更多选项。

    库和框架:

    • 第三方插件:如Bootstrap、jQuery UI等,简化开发过程。
    • 自定义函数:封装常用逻辑便于复用和维护。

    后端程序开发与管理数据库

    后端主要负责处理服务器端的业务逻辑和数据存储。

    数据库设计:

    • ER图绘制:理清实体之间的关系,确定字段类型和约束条件。
    • 索引优化:加快查询速度,特别是对于大型数据库尤为重要。

    业务逻辑处理:

    • 请求路由:分发HTTP请求到相应的

    标签: #源码如何建立网站

黑狐家游戏
  • 评论列表

留言评论